Jabal Bal`id
Jabal Bal`id is a peak in Bani Qa’is District, Hajjah Governorate and has an elevation of 411 metres. Jabal Bal`id is situated nearby to the hamlet Shi`b Bal`id, as well as near Al Maramid.- Type: Peak with an elevation of 411 metres
